Violet is found living in a squalid apartment, having abandoned her ambitions for a life of gambling and bad decisions.

The episode centers on Christy and Bonnie rushing to help a supposedly sick Violet, who has contracted mono. However, they quickly discover that her physical illness is the least of her concerns.
